Output 32bf356918c741a6f6f90d3ef612b92b2bbf83ac38937ad383ea0545b18891ed:3

value
2834406710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a86ee8ea7aa430ca4f87bdd9e2f05a8a9f1263a OP_EQUAL
address
32egKh7JM6U1sVc1QMt7DRYrehNk5XF4AA
transaction
32bf356918c741a6f6f90d3ef612b92b2bbf83ac38937ad383ea0545b18891ed
spent
true